Your problem ""Htmlmarq.ocx " was unable to register itself in the system registry" is typical of what happens when installing Office 97 on a computer running Windows XP if Windows XP Service Pack 2 is installed. There are fixes and work arounds but first, let me say you'd be ahead of the game to get a later version of Office, there are a lot of changes in the newer versions. Here's three methods to get it to install: 1. If your copy of XP doesn't have SP2 pre installed, remove it using add/remove. Then install Office 97, install all the Office 97 updates and then re-install SP2. This is the best but not always possible. 2. If you can't do the above, do a custom install of Office 97 and de- select all the HTML options. This leaves you w/o any of the HTML options so you might want to try this: 3. Open regedit and browse to this key: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ows NT\CurrentVersion\Image File Execution Options You should see htmlmarq.ocx and htmlmm.ocx separate keys. Rename them to something else, ie. htmlmarq.tmp and htmlmm.tmp. You will now be able to install Office 97, including the HTML option, without incident. This doesn't always work, it didn't for me but if it does the problem is solved! NOTE: The fixes/workarounds above are credited to several different posters, I can't claim any credit for them. Another NOTE: You're still better off to upgrade to a newer version of Office if you can swing the cost. Office 97 has problems installing on Windows XP SP2. Therefore, if you have anyways to uninstall SP2 then do so othewise you will need Office 2003. You can only uninstall SP2 if your version of XP is Pre SP1 or with SP1 and you installed SP2 manually or using autoupdate. Check in Control panel if there is an entry for SP2 patch. If there is then you can uninstall from there. hth Sheba53 wrote: I have just got a laptop and it won't let me install office 97 even with my cd-code.
